The Raspberry Jams is an album[1]. It ranks in the top 2% of album ent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(48 views/month).[2]
Key Facts
- The Raspberry Jams's instance of is recorded as album[3].
- The Raspberry Jams's genre is instrumental rock[4].
- The Raspberry Jams followed Perspective[5].
- The Raspberry Jams was followed by The Blackberry Jams[6].
- The Raspberry Jams was produced by Jason Becker[7].
- Among the performers on The Raspberry Jams was Jason Becker[8].
- The Raspberry Jams's record label is recorded as Shrapnel Records[9].
- The Raspberry Jams was published on January 1, 1999[10].
- The Raspberry Jams's form of creative work is recorded as compilation album[11].
